*wink* I hate hydrogas with a passion.

I kind of stole the idea from Watsons Rally who use inboard coils for their honda conversion on the K series Metro/R100 subframe they use for it. They supplied the coil kit and I bunged it on my subframe. It was about a ton or so for the coil conversion.

You'd need to speak to Carl about the arms which he made especially to suit the metro arm config I need for my car, so he has a jig for them now.
